Abstract

Feature extraction can be done on an objects in the form of images using several features. Feature extraction can be combined with the science of biometrics. Biometrics are unique dan measurable physical or biological characteristics. Biometric identification can be used to improve security dan avoid using fake identities. In this case, uses the palm of the object of research because palm has unique features that are different for each individual. In addition to unique features, the palm surface area is one of the authors' considerations in determining the object of research. The surface area of ​​the palm is greater than the surface area of ​​one finger. One method that can be utilized in the identification process is the LBP (Local Binary Pattern) feature extraction method that applies neighboring distances dan the number of neighbors compared. It starts with the Pre-processing stage or the preparation stage of the color image which will be transformed into a gray image dan then followed by a regioning process or image sharing process into several sub-regions. Followed by feature extraction stages with the LBP method. The highest accuracy results obtained from this study amounted to 92.31% with neighboring distance 2, number of neighbors compared = 8, number of regions = 16 dan number of shares height = 4 dan width = 4.
